Technically, no. If you are accepting credit cards from them, you can make their credit card statement line item say whatever you want and you can receive the money direct to your bank account (assuming Stripe usage).

If you receive the payments as an individual (as an American), you'll have them taxed at the normal federal income tax rate, state tax rate, and local tax rate, so you'll have to set aside 50% of your income for taxes.

If you're not sure how successful your venture will be, start off taking payments to yourself. If you grow bigger, then put a company behind it. It's annoying to form a corporation, maintain the paperwork on it, then end up only processing $50/month through it.
